Hughes Votes Early at 7.05 AM in New York Laundry

Charles E. Hughes cast his ballot at 7.05 AM in a small laundry at 716 Eighth Avenue New York. He noted his ballot number thirteen and remarked Jo was born on Friday. A small crowd and photographers surrounded him as he exited, smiling at a backfiring taxicab and smoke behind a stalled car near his campaign headquarters. He returned to the hotel for a quiet day ahead.

City to flash lights signaling election result

The Enterprise will use electric lights citywide to announce the presidential result after AP confirms Hughes or Wilson. Lights will flash three times if Wilson wins and five times if Hughes wins, excluding street arcs, via North Carolina Public Service Company cooperation.

Federal game preserve created in Pisgah National Forest

Washington November 7. The Pisgah national forest in western North Carolina is made a federal game preserve under a proclamation by the President. It is the first federal game preserve of its kind to be created east of the Mississippi.

Actual paving to commence in High Point soon

Work to lay drainage and sewer pipes on South Main Street has finished and paving will start. Contractors Lassiter & Co will lay a concrete base within two weeks and weather delays are not expected to hinder completion by spring. A funding tie up with North Carolina Public Service Co remains unresolved as city and company negotiate payroll and supervision terms.
